How to create a unique status yourself
The best status is your own, born in the moment. You don't need to be a poet to describe your feelings. It's enough to be honest. Sincerity always read between the lines and valued above borrowed wisdom.
Try the “five senses” technique: describe what you see, hear, feel on your skin, smell and taste at this moment. This will make the description come alive.
Start small. Describe the smell of the sea, the sound of the wind in the palm trees, or the taste of an unfamiliar fruit. Details create atmosphere. Avoid clichés like “paradise” or “unforgettable experience” - they don’t say anything about a specific place.
⚠️ Attention: Avoid using too complex metaphors that only you understand. The status must be understandable to a wide audience.
Practice writing short notes every day. This develops the skill of formulating thoughts. In a month, you will notice that your texts have become brighter and more imaginative.

How to correctly use hashtags in statuses?
Hashtags must be relevant. Don't use #love or #happy unless it's in context. It is better to use specific location or topic tags, for example: #Altai mountains #vacation with children #philosophy of travel. The optimal quantity is from 3 to 10 pieces.
Is it possible to copy statuses from others?
Copying verbatim is bad practice. Algorithms may consider it spam, and friends will recognize other people's thoughts. It's better to take an idea and rewrite it in your own words, adding personal experience.
